Boy, was this list hard to make! Sure, some were easy - very easy. But I really thought I knew my herd better than this before I started. I thought I'd be able to fill out all of the categories just based on my knowledge of my bunnies. I filled in as much as I could, then I had to make a trip to the barn.
I went around, comparing crowns and checking shoulders. I caused quite a stir, walking around and reaching into cages.
I could easily add another superlative: Best Most Eager To Breed. Mistoffelees fell out of the cage once and almost twice trying to romance my arm! He is one hyper fellow. Lucky for him, he's a cute guy and made my superlative list more than once.
I learned a lot about my herd from doing this exercise. I'm willing to wager that you'll learn a lot if you do the same thing with your herd. You may want to use some different or additional categories.
I believe I'm going to print out my list and keep it handy next time I make breeding choices. And I'll need to do this again in about six months to keep up with a changing herd.
